Director, Operations (Outpatient), Full Time, Central California Network

Adventist Health is a faith-based, nonprofit, integrated health system serving over 100 communities on the West Coast and Hawaii. The Director of Operations (Outpatient) is responsible for directing outpatient operations, ensuring high quality, cost-effective medical services, and overseeing clinical, quality, administrative, and fiscal aspects of the organization.

Responsibilities

Works with site medical expense team to provide direction for actions to control targeted costs for inpatient and outpatient services
Conducts regular agenda driven meetings with staff to address issues, concerns, and to communicate mission of organization
Directs, organizes and plans the operation of assigned clinics
Strategizes with the senior staff regarding program expansion, business development and new care models
Focuses on quality improvement, utilization and reducing medical costs while incorporating the skills of provider partners whenever possible
Provides leadership to staff, giving direction and guidance to managers and staff as appropriate
Plans, budgets, organizes and manages the department to accomplish operational and strategic objectives
Analyzes and interprets complex data sets and reports, i.e., variance analysis, financial/quality, population specific reports
Performs other job-related duties as assigned
